Facts about One Thing

✔️

Who wrote One Thing lyrics?


One Thing is written and performed by Neil Young.
✔️

When was One Thing released?


It is first released on April 12, 1988 as part of Neil Young's album "This Note's for You" which includes 10 tracks in total. This song is the 9th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is One Thing?


One Thing falls under the genre Rock.
✔️

Who produced One Thing?


One Thing is produced by Neil Young, Niko Bolas.
✔️

How long is the song One Thing?


One Thing song length is 6 minutes and 02 seconds.
